An Overview on Divine Herb Apamarga (Achyranthes aspera Linn.)
Authors: Gurjar Hemwati and Kotecha Mita
Number of views: 763
In the present era Ayurvedic herbal drugs are getting popular all over the world.The demand of
herbal drugs is increasing progressively due to their admirable efficacy, lesser side effect and
good belief by communities. One of the important herb used in Ayurvedais Apamarga
(Achyranthes aspera Linn.) which is also known as a Prickly chaff flower. This plant was
extensively used since Vedic kala.It has lots of references in theVedas and Ayurvedic literature
not only for medicinal usage, but also for its astrological relevance.Due to high medicinal
values of this plant it has got the honour of “Lord of all plants on earth” in Vedas.According
to Ayurvedait is best for Shirovirechanaand also useful inKarnaroga, Krimi, Pandu,Arsha,
Kushtha, Unmada, Apasmara, Ashmari, Hikka-Swaas, VishChikitsa,etc.Modern researches
have also highlighted its different pharmacological actions like Antimicrobial, Antifertility,
Anti-arthritic, Anti cancerous, Anti asthmatic, Anti asthmatic, Renal disorders, Wound healing
activity, Hepatoprotective, Anti depressant activity, Analgesic, antipyretic etc
